Someone vandalized a touching Burnaby tribute to Ukraine

Message includes debunked Russian claim.

A lovely mural telling people to “stand with Ukraine” that had been painted recently in Burnaby has been vandalized with misinformation.

The mural had been painted at a construction site on Wilson Avenue in the Metrotown area.

Someone has since altered the mural (see the before and after photos above) that includes the word “Nazis” in relation to Ukraine, which has been invaded by Russia.

The reference relates to a claim spread by Russia that one of the reasons why it had invaded Ukraine was to stop “Nazis” in the country. The claim has been widely discredited as most of the world has stood behind Ukraine.

Burnaby RCMP were not formally contacted but sent officers to the scene, said a police statement. The mural artist was on scene covering up the message and police are now reviewing video near the scene for a possible suspect.
